What is Oatmeal Cake?

Oatmeal Cake is a moist and flavorful cake made with oats as a primary ingredient. It’s often enriched with spices like cinnamon and nutmeg and can include additional ingredients such as raisins, nuts, or coconut for added texture and flavor. The oats give the cake a hearty texture and a subtle nutty taste, making it a unique and satisfying treat.

Oatmeal Cake Rec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 cup rolled oats (use gluten-free oats for a gluten-free version)
  • 1 ¼ cups boiling water
  • ½ cup unsalted butter (or coconut oil for a dairy-free version)
  • 1 cup brown sugar (can substitute with coconut sugar for a healthier option)
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 ⅓ cups all-purpose flour (or a gluten-free flour blend)
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on nutmeg
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9x13-inch baking dish and set it aside.
  2. Soak the Oats: In a large bowl, combine the rolled oats with boiling water. Let them soak for about 20 minutes until they are softened.
  3. Mix the Batter: In a separate bowl, cream together the butter and sugars until light and fluffy. Beat in the eggs, one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ract.
  4. Combine Ingredients: Add the soaked oats to the butter mixture and stir until well combined. In another b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until just combined.
  5. Bake: Pour the batter into the prepared baking dish.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Allow the cake to cool in the pan before slicing.

Optional Toppings

  • Coconut and Brown Sugar Topping: Combine ¼ cup melted butter, ½ cup brown sugar, ½ cup shredded coconut, and ¼ cup chopped nuts. Spread over the warm cake and broil for 2-3 minutes until bubbly.
  • Cream Cheese Frosting: For a sweeter finish, top the cake with cream cheese frosting.

Nutritional Information

Per Serving (Based on 12 servings)

  • Calories: 250
  • Carbohydrates: 40g
  • Protein: 4g
  • Fat: 10g
  • Fiber: 2g
  • Sugar: 25g

Oatmeal Cake FAQs

What are some healthy variations or substitutions that can be made in a traditional oatmeal cake recipe to enhance its nutritional value?

To enhance the nutritional value of your Oatmeal Cake, consider making the following substitutions:

  • Use Coconut Oil Instead of Butter: This reduces the saturated fat content and adds a hint of coconut flavor.
  • Swap Out Sugars: Replace granulated sugar with natural sweeteners like honey, maple syrup, or coconut sugar.
  • Add Seeds or Nuts: Incorporate chia seeds, flaxseeds, or chopped nuts for extra fiber and omega-3 fatty acids.

Can an oatmeal cake be made gluten-free, and if so, what ingredients would you need to substitute in the recipe?

Yes, Oatmeal Cake can be easily made gluten-free. Simply use certified gluten-free oats and replace the all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end. Ensure all other ingredients, such as baking powder, are also gluten-free.

What are the best methods for storing oatmeal cake to ensure it stays moist and fresh for an extended period?

To keep your Oatmeal Cake moist and fresh, follow these storage tips:

  • Room Temperature: Store the c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.
  • Refrigeration: Refrigerate the cake to extend its freshness for up to a week.
  • Freezing: Wrap the cake tightly in plastic wrap, then in aluminum foil, and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w at room temperature or warm slices in the oven before serving.
